  • @Slaanesh1000
    @Slaanesh1000 4 роки тому

    Nice work in general but why grey on the hull. Normally the black would be down to the point where the copper sheath coats the keel and that part of the hull. I don't know if the Spanish and French had started doing this but in the second half of the 1700's the RN had a huge speed advantage over its rivals because of that copper sheathing. It stopped sea life growing on the wooden hull, made deguassing easier made the ships faster.

    • @threesquarewheels
      @threesquarewheels 4 роки тому

      Slaanesh1000 yeah you're probably right. Once I add the sea texture on the base you hardly see it anyway. I just wanted a contrast from the black upper hull and I didn't want to paint the hull a copper colour or (green after its developed a patina) as that would look funny at this small scale.
